Empirical value, mean value: _EVNUM

General information
The effect of empirical and mean values is described in the chapter "General section,
measuring principle and measurement strategy".
The empirical values and mean values are stored in data block (GUD5) in arrays
• _EV[ ] empirical values and
• _MV[ ] mean values.
The unit of measurement is mm in the metric basic system and inch in the inch basic system,
irrespective of the active system of units.
The number of existing empirical and mean values is entered in data block (GUD6)
_EVMVNUM[ m,n].
• m: array dimension _EV[m]
• n: array dimension _MV[n]
